Schedule A. Services (Little Canada) <br /> <br />Web Streaming Services: <br />The NSAC agrees to provide the following: <br />● Live web streaming of planned 48 meetings. <br />● Encoded meetings and the accompanying agendas posted within 24 hours <br />on the NSAC’s website. <br />● Post links between agenda items and their video discussion. <br />● Storage of recorded videos for up to 12 months. <br /> <br />The city agrees to provide the following: <br />• Provide NSAC with monthly schedule of all live meetings to be streamed and/or <br />encoded for posting on the NSAC’s website. <br />• Notify the NSAC as soon as possible of the cancellation of a live event, including <br />city meeting, which is scheduled for playback, of any change in the day <br />or beginning time of any live event, including city meeting, or of any <br />additions of special meeting to the schedule. <br />• Provide the NSAC with the name and telephone number for a main <br />contact of the cablecast. <br />• Chapter marking information on the agenda will be provided by the <br />city for meetings not utilizing the NSAC’s municipal producers. <br /> <br /> <br /> <br /> <br />$60 <br />per actual <br />web stream <br />event <br /> <br />[Maximum <br />of only one <br />stream charge <br />per night] <br /> <br /> <br />Equipment Monitoring Cost Share <br />The NSAC agrees to provide the following: <br />● (11) IP based devices monitored via the inter-mapper license, to ensure <br />equipment is operating effectively, and reduce breakage. <br />● This is an even cost share with the JPA. <br /> <br /> <br />$132 <br />per year <br />[$11/mo.] <br /> <br /> <br />Neighborhood Network Services: <br />The NSAC agrees to provide the following: <br />• Produce coverage of at least 3 city events per year, at the discretion of the <br />NSAC. <br />• Cablecast, make available online and distribute via link to the city the <br /> final product. <br />• Storage of recorded videos for up to 12 months. <br /> <br />The city agrees to provide the following: <br />● Submit the event coverage request to the NSAC, which will only be accepted <br />from either the City Administrator, City Council member or Staff that has been <br />designated for communications. <br /> <br /> <br /> <br />$1 <br />per year <br /> <br /> <br />Cassandar Web Streaming Platform: <br />The NSAC agrees to provide the following: <br />● Custom branded landing page with city logo & colors for city content. <br />● Ability to index, create chapters and upload agendas. <br />● Hosting and maintenance of the online platform and site. <br />● Dedicated messaging system from constituents to assigned email to answer <br />questions from the public. Password protection options <br /> <br /> <br />$5,000 <br />per year <br />value <br /> <br />Included <br />in JPA <br />Membership <br />
